    Description: Designed to withstand the thermal extremes of the STS-3 mission through the use of heaters and thermal blankets, the plasma diagnostics package sat on the release/engagement mechanism on the OSS-1 payload pallet without a coldplate and was attached to the RMS for two extended periods. Plots show temperature versus mission elapsed time for two temperature sensors. Pressure in the range of 10 to the -3 power torr and 10 to the -7 power torr, measured 3 inches from the skin of the package is plotted against GMT during the mission. The most distinctive feature of the pressure profile is the modulation at the obit period. It was found that pressure peaks when the atmospheric gas is rammed into the cargo bay. Electric and magnetic noise spectra and time variability due to orbiter systems, UHF and S-band transmitter field strengths, and measurements of the ion spectra obtained both in the cargo bay and during experiments are plotted.

    Description: Primary objectives of the Plasma Diagnostics Package (PDP) on STS-3 as part of the OSS-1 'Pathfinder' payload were to measure aspects of the Orbiter's induced environment and to utilize Orbiter crew and subsystems in the conduct of scientific investigations. Instrumentation temperatures were found to be within predicted limits, payload bay pressure varied from ambient up to 0.001 torr with thruster firings, EMI levels were found to be below worst case estimates, and V x B motional potentials were observed to vary + or - 5 V with respect to Orbiter ground. These parameters exhibited orbit-period modulation. Payload bay plasma varied in density and composition from ambient to a rarefied mixture with Orbiter-produced H2O(+). Energetic electrons and ions with energies up to 10's of eV were observed occasionally. Primary and vernier thrusters induce a momentary perturbation to the electron density, to the pressure and to the electric field with low energy ions and electrons occasionally produced. With the PDP on the RMS, both automode and manual modes were used to seek sources of EMI, to characterize the Orbiter's plasma wake and to measure beam-plasma phenomena.

    Description: The third Space Shuttle mission's OSS-1 payload included 30 Hz-800 MHz and S-band receivers which assessed the intentional (transmitter) and unintentional (subsystem) EMI levels. It was noted that, at the pallet location, the UHF voice downlink transmitter field strengths did not exceed 0.1 V/m. At the remote manipulator system, the figure was 0.5 V/m. Below 300 kHz, the magnetic field noise was 30 dB pT + or - 20 dB, while the electric field noise was broadband and variable over at least 60 dB, depending on thruster firings and Orbiter attitude. This noise may have been generated by the Orbiter's interaction with the ambient plasma.
